Tyson Williamson (Regina, SK) finished 1-3 in the 13-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Williamson lost 9-1 to Matthew Mourot (Saskatoon, SK), droppimg another game, 7-6 to Ben Gamble (Moose Jaw, SK) where Williamson responded with a 6-1 win over Garrett Springer (Regina, SK). Williamson went on to lose 6-2 against Ryan Deis (Fox Valley, SK) in their final qualifying round match.
Williamson earned 0.211 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ins, moving up 322 spots the World Ranking Standings into 410th place overall with 0.211 total points. Williamson ranks 226th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 0.211 points earned so far this season.
